โฆ Synopsis
A simplified method along with a proof is proposed in this paper to find the equivalence conditions in a class of linear distributed parameter systems. The proposed method is illustrated for (i) diffusion equations, (ii) wave equations and (iii) lateral vibration of bars; all with three spatial coordinates.
